Is Forex trading psychological or technical?

(Free-Press-Release.com) February 7, 2012 -- This question has arisen many times in our industry. For some reason people struggle to find the answer but once you start your Forex training you will realize that it is both. For a start, to trade you need a computer and so therefore some basic technical skills. It also requires money which is probably the most psychologically damaging item in the world. So, trading is both psychological and technical - what does that mean? What is more important? What do we need to master? Why does either matter?

Consider parachute jumping. This sport also requires a fairly equal balance of both psychological and technical skills throughout the entire career. If you ever fail to pack your parachute in the correct technical way or if you lose the psychological ability to jump, you will not be a world class parachute jumper.

Now consider being a rocket scientist. Your entire career revolves around knowledge, understanding and learning. And not your psychological limitations and not governed by your psychological traits.

A professional Forex trader is almost the exact opposite to being a rocket scientist, and this is why trying to become a professional trader is so prevalent around the world. Once you have learnt the technical aspects of trading such as using the trading software, creating and understanding money management strategies and creating a trading strategy you could be set for life. Notwithstanding software and hardware upgrades you may never have to hone or adapt your technical trading skills again. Because of the very low technical requirements some people think that this means trading is simple and can be learnt very quickly and even self taught. Unfortunately, the trading world is filled with shrewd, intelligent and able traders who thrive on those people.

How can trading be so hard if it requires so little technical skills?

Trading isn’t a battle between you and other traders; it’s not even a battle between you and your broker. It is 100%, completely and totally, a battle between yourself, and yourself. You are in control of your future, your success and your failure. There is no boss to blame, no tool that hasn’t worked properly, never any excuses. Every time you place a trade it was your decision, your analysis and your account that will deal with the repercussions.

How do I beat myself?

A technical skill can be mastered with more effort, more reading, more studying. A psychological skill cannot. The only way you can get better at trading (once you have mastered the technical stuff!) is with experience – a whole lot of it.
